数据库ref是什么意思

不及物动词 其他 90

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库ref是指数据库引用(Database Reference)的缩写。在数据库中,ref通常是用来表示两个表之间的关联关系的一种方式。它通过在一个表中存储对另一个表的引用来建立表与表之间的连接。

    下面是关于数据库ref的五个重要点:

    1. 关联关系:数据库ref用于建立表与表之间的关联关系。通过在一个表中存储对另一个表的引用,可以实现数据的关联查询和数据的一致性维护。

    2. 外键:在数据库中,ref通常是通过外键(Foreign Key)来实现的。外键是一个表中的列,它存储了对另一个表中主键的引用。通过外键,可以实现表与表之间的关联。

    3. 关联查询:通过数据库ref,可以进行关联查询。关联查询是指在查询时同时查询两个或多个表,并根据表之间的关联关系来获取相关的数据。通过关联查询,可以实现更复杂的数据查询操作。

    4. 数据一致性维护:数据库ref还可以用于维护数据的一致性。通过在一个表中存储对另一个表的引用,可以确保引用的数据的存在性和完整性。当引用的数据发生变化时,可以通过数据库ref来更新相关的数据,从而保持数据的一致性。

    5. 约束:数据库ref还可以用于定义约束。通过在表之间建立关联关系,可以定义一些约束条件,如主键约束、唯一约束、外键约束等。通过约束,可以保证数据的完整性和一致性。

    综上所述,数据库ref是用来建立表与表之间关联关系的一种方式。通过ref,可以实现数据的关联查询、数据的一致性维护和约束的定义。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    在数据库中,REF是一种引用关系,用于建立两个表之间的连接。REF是“引用”(Reference)的缩写,它表示一个表中的某个字段引用另一个表中的主键字段。

    REF的使用可以有效地建立表与表之间的关系,实现数据的一对一或一对多的关联。通过REF,可以在一个表中通过引用另一个表的主键字段,实现对相关数据的访问和操作。

    在创建表时,可以使用REF关键字来定义引用关系。例如,有两个表A和B,表A中有一个字段a_id,它引用了表B的主键字段b_id,那么可以使用REF关键字定义这个引用关系:

    CREATE TABLE A (
    a_id INT PRIMARY KEY,
    b REF B
    );

    CREATE TABLE B (
    b_id INT PRIMARY KEY
    );

    通过上述定义,表A中的字段b被定义为引用表B的主键字段b_id。这样,当在表A中插入数据时,可以通过REF来引用表B中的数据。例如,插入一条数据到表A中:

    INSERT INTO A VALUES (1, REF(SELECT * FROM B WHERE b_id = 1));

    上述语句中,通过REF关键字引用了表B中b_id为1的数据。这样,就可以在表A中使用REF来访问和操作表B中的数据。

    总结来说,数据库中的REF是一种引用关系,用于建立表与表之间的连接。通过REF,可以在一个表中引用另一个表的主键字段,实现对相关数据的访问和操作。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    数据库中的ref是指引用(reference)的意思。在数据库中,引用是指一个数据元素使用另一个数据元素的标识符或地址来表示对它的依赖或关联。

    在关系型数据库中,引用通常通过外键(foreign key)来实现。外键是指一个表中的字段,它引用了另一个表中的主键(primary key)。通过外键,我们可以在一个表中建立对另一个表的引用关系,实现表与表之间的关联。

    在非关系型数据库中,引用的实现方式可能有所不同。例如,在文档型数据库中,可以使用对象引用的方式来建立文档之间的关联。在键值对数据库中,可以使用键的值来引用另一个键值对。

    无论是关系型数据库还是非关系型数据库,引用都是用来建立数据之间的关联关系,使得数据之间可以相互访问和使用。通过引用,我们可以在不同的数据之间建立关联,提高数据的组织性和查询效率。

    数据库中的引用还可以用于维护数据的完整性。通过引用约束(reference constraint),我们可以限制引用的完整性,确保引用的数据是存在的并且一致的。例如,在关系型数据库中,可以通过设置外键约束来确保引用的数据在被引用表中存在。

    总之,数据库中的ref是指引用,用于建立数据之间的关联关系,并且可以用于维护数据的完整性。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部